Nintendo Game Card
A Nintendo Game Card is a proprietary flash storage-based format used to physically distribute video games for certain Nintendo systems. The game cards resemble both smaller and thinner versions of Hudson's HuCard, the storage medium for the PC-Engine, and the Game Pak ROM cartridges used for previous portable gaming consoles released by Nintendo, such as the Game Boy and Game Boy Advance. The mask ROM chips are manufactured by Macronix and have an access speed of 150  ns. Nintendo DS Nintendo DS Game Card Cards for the Nintendo DS ranged from 64 megabits to 4 gigabits (8–512  MB) in capacity The cards contain an integrated flash memory for game data and an EEPROM to save user data such as game progress or high scores. However, there are a small number of games that have no save memory such as ''Electroplankton''. Flash ROM
Flash memory is an electronic non-volatile computer memory storage medium that can be electrically erased and reprogrammed. The two main types of flash memory, NOR flash and NAND flash, are named for the NOR and NAND logic gates. Both use the same cell design, consisting of floating gate MOSFETs. They differ at the circuit level depending on whether the state of the bit line or word lines is pulled high or low: in NAND flash, the relationship between the bit line and the word lines resembles a NAND gate; in NOR flash, it resembles a NOR gate. Flash memory, a type of floating-gate memory, was invented at Toshiba in 1980 and is based on EEPROM technology. Toshiba began marketing flash memory in 1987. EPROMs had to be erased completely before they could be rewritten. NAND flash memory, however, may be erased, written, and read in blocks (or pages), which generally are much smaller than the entire device. Game Pak
Game Pak is the brand name for ROM cartridges designed by Nintendo for some of their earlier video game systems. The "Game Pak" moniker was officially used only in North America, Europe, and Oceania. In Japan, as well as other Asian territories and Latin America, these cartridges were officially called . Nintendo Entertainment System Super Nintendo Entertainment System Nintendo 64 Game Boy All cartridges, excluding those for Game Boy Advance, measure 5.8 by 6.5 cm. The cartridge provides the code and game data to the console's CPU. Some cartridges include a small battery with SRAM, flash memory chip, or EEPROM, which allows game data to be saved when the console is turned off. If the battery runs out in a cartridge, then the save data will be lost, however, it is possible to replace the battery with a new battery. Backbone Entertainment
Backbone Entertainment was an American video game developer based in Emeryville, California. The company was formed in 2003 as the result of a merger between developers Digital Eclipse and ImaginEngine. In 2005, Backbone merged with The Collective (company), The Collective to form Foundation 9 Entertainment. History Backbone Entertainment was formed in 2003 through a merger between Digital Eclipse, a developer of Video game emulation, emulations of arcade games, and ImaginEngine, an edutainment games developer. ImaginEngine remained an independent studio, based in Framingham, Massachusetts, while Digital Eclipse's studios were absorbed by Backbone, becoming Backbone Emeryville and Backbone Vancouver, respectively. In 2004, in co-operation with the University of Hawaii, Backbone opened an office in Honolulu, Hawaii, under the lead of Backbone's chairman, Mark Loughridge. Electroplankton
is an interactive music video game developed by indieszero and published by Nintendo for the Nintendo DS handheld game console, handheld video game console. It was first released in Japan in 2005, and was later released in North America and Europe in 2006. This game allows the player to interact with animated plankton and create music through one of ten different plankton themed interfaces. The first edition of ''Electroplankton'' in Japan is bundled with a set of blue colored ear bud headphones. Gameplay The game offers two game modes: Performance and Audience. Performance mode allows the user to interact with the plankton through use of the stylus, touchscreen, and microphone. Audience mode is like a demo mode, which simply allows the user to put down the system and enjoy a continuous musical show by all of the plankton, although the user can interact with the plankton just like in Performance mode. EEPROM
EEPROM (also called E2PROM) stands for electrically erasable programmable read-only memory and is a type of non-volatile memory used in computers, usually integrated in microcontrollers such as smart cards and remote keyless systems, or as a separate chip device to store relatively small amounts of data by allowing individual bytes to be erased and reprogrammed. EEPROMs are organized as arrays of floating-gate transistors. EEPROMs can be programmed and erased in-circuit, by applying special programming signals. Originally, EEPROMs were limited to single-byte operations, which made them slower, but modern EEPROMs allow multi-byte page operations. An EEPROM has a limited life for erasing and reprogramming, now reaching a million operations in modern EEPROMs. In an EEPROM that is frequently reprogrammed, the life of the EEPROM is an important design consideration. Gigabits
The bit is the most basic unit of information in computing and digital communications. The name is a portmanteau of binary digit. The bit represents a logical state with one of two possible values. These values are most commonly represented as either , but other representations such as ''true''/''false'', ''yes''/''no'', ''on''/''off'', or ''+''/''−'' are also commonly used. The relation between these values and the physical states of the underlying storage or device is a matter of convention, and different assignments may be used even within the same device or program. It may be physically implemented with a two-state device. The symbol for the binary digit is either "bit" per recommendation by the IEC 80000-13:2008 standard, or the lowercase character "b", as recommended by the IEEE 1541-2002 standard. Megabits
The megabit is a multiple of the unit bit for digital information. The prefix mega (symbol M) is defined in the International System of Units (SI) as a multiplier of 106 (1 million), and therefore :1 megabit = = = 1000 kilobits. The megabit has the unit symbol Mbit or Mb. The lowercase 'b' in Mb distinguishes it from MB (for megabyte). The megabit is closely related to the mebibit, a unit multiple derived from the binary prefix mebi (symbol Mi) of the same order of magnitude, which is equal to = , or approximately 5% larger than the megabit. Despite the definitions of these new prefixes for binary-based quantities of storage by international standards organizations, memory semiconductor chips are still marketed using the metric prefix names to designate binary multiples. is a Japanese multinational video game company headquartered in Kyoto, Japan. It develops video games and video game consoles. Nintendo was founded in 1889 as by craftsman Fusajiro Yamauchi and originally produced handmade playing cards. After venturing into various lines of business during the 1960s and acquiring a legal status as a public company, Nintendo distributed its first console, the Color TV-Game, in 1977. It gained international recognition with the release of ''Donkey Kong'' in 1981 and the Nintendo Entertainment System and ''Super Mario Bros.'' in 1985. Since then, Nintendo has produced some of the most successful consoles in the video game industry, such as the Game Boy, the Super Nintendo Entertainment System, the Nintendo DS, the Wii, and the Switch. Nanoseconds
A nanosecond (ns) is a unit of time in the International System of Units (SI) equal to one billionth of a second, that is, of a second, or 10 seconds. The term combines the SI prefix ''nano-'' indicating a 1 billionth submultiple of an SI unit (e.g. nanogram, nanometre, etc.) and ''second'', the primary unit of time in the SI. A nanosecond is equal to 1000 picoseconds or  microsecond. Time units ranging between 10 and 10 seconds are typically expressed as tens or hundreds of nanoseconds. Time units of this granularity are commonly found in telecommunications, pulsed lasers, and related aspects of electronics.
